PMI Project Management Ready
This program provides a comprehensive introduction to project management principles and practices, emphasizing real-world application across diverse professional settings. Through lecture, discussion, and the use of an interactive online platform, participants will gain essential tools and techniques to integrate project management into their daily work.
Learning Outcomes:
By the end of this course, participants will be able to:
- Explain core project management concepts and terminology
- Apply predictive (plan-based) and adaptive (agile) methodologies to real-world projects.
- Understand the role of business analysts in project environments
- Successfully prepare for the PMI Project Management Ready certification exam.
Certification:
PMI Project Management Ready (PMR) is an entry-level credential from the Project Management Institute (PMI) that validates readiness to manage projects effectively. The exam is included in the tuition and can be taken at the CEI Testing Center upon completion of this class.
